'We are ready for the worst'
Jerusalem Post ^ | 10/29/4 | MATTHEW GUTMAN

Posted on 10/28/2004 8:29:49 PM PDT by SmithL

If all goes as planned – and nothing does – ailing Palestinian Authority Chairman Yasser Arafat will be eased onto a plane bound for Paris Friday morning. For the Palestinians, it will mark the first day of the rest of their lives.

"Arafat is a symbol that comes once every 300 years," Kadoura Fares, a Palestinian Legislative Council member and part of Fatah's so-called Young Guard, told reporters Thursday.

Still, he added, "Yes, thank God, we are ready for the worst." That is, for Arafat's death and the subsequent succession process. Oddly in a region of the world so infamous for anarchy, Palestinian politicians are relying heavily on PA laws to help them navigate the crisis.

"There is a great possibility of smooth succession if everyone abides by the law," said Abdel Jawad Saleh, a PLC member and former minister in one of Arafat's constantly reshuffled cabinets.

But Arafat's shoes are big ones to fill. Palestinian politicians believe that his power will have to be distributed. No man should wield so much power over a polity that aspires toward democracy. Therefore, a caretaker government of a few top PLO officials will take over. Or Rauhi Fattouh, the hitherto unknown speaker of the PLC, will take over for a period of 60 days until elections.

According to reports, Arafat called Mahmoud Abbas and Ahmed Qurei to his side, like a patriarch on his deathbed. As secretary-general of the PLO, Abbas is the frontrunner to assume the reins of leadership, but there are other forces at play.
